Andrea Lisuzzo (born 26 January 1981) is a former Italian footballer. Lisuzzo has played over 200 matches in Serie C1/Lega Pro Prima Divisione.

Career edit

Born in Palermo, Lisuzzo started his career at hometown club Palermo. He then played for Foggia of Serie C1, Fano, Martina and again Foggia.[1] On 23 May 2009 he agreed a new 2-year contract with Foggia.[2]

Novara edit

On 7 July 2009 he was transferred to Novara.[3] He was a regular starter of the team, winning promotion twice, which the team would play in 2011–12 Serie A.

Spezia edit

On 10 July 2013 Lisuzzo joined Spezia Calcio.[4]

Pisa edit

On 30 July 2014 Lisuzzo joined A.C. Pisa 1909.[5]
